Typical Faults


Common dishwashing machine faults might range from small to major ones. Relying on the extent, you will either need the services of professional plumbing professionals to deal with or replace it.
Several of the most common faults include:

Leaky Dishwasher


This is most likely one of the most day-to-day dishwashing machine trouble, and the good news is that it is easy to determine. Leakages occur because of several reasons, as well as the leaks can bungle your kitchen. Common causes of dishwasher leaks consist of;
  • Inappropriate pipe link: If the pipelines at the back of your device are not firmly fixed or if they are worn out, it can trigger leakages.

  • Inappropriate dish piling: Constantly make certain that you do not overstack the tray which you set up the meals effectively

  • Way too much cleaning agent: Putting ample detergent could additionally cause a leak. Make certain that you put simply enough for your dishes and also not a lot more.

  • Rust: It might additionally be an outcome of some corrosion or corrosion of your equipment. In this instance, it is better to change the dishwashing machine.

  • Door Seals: Examine if the door seals are still undamaged as well as securely attached. If the seals are not in position, maybe a significant root cause of leaks.

  • Bad-Smelling Dish washer


    This is another usual dishwasher trouble, and also it is primarily brought on by food debris or grease remaining in the equipment. In this instance, seek these fragments, take them out as well as do the dishes without any dishes inside the machine. Clean the filter completely. That will certainly assist remove the bad scent. Make certain that you remove every food fragment from your meals prior to moving it to the device in the future.

    Inability to Drain pipes


    Occasionally you may notice a big quantity of water left in your tub after a laundry. That is most likely a water drainage problem. You can either examine the drainpipe tube for damages or obstructions. When in doubt, speak to a specialist to have it examined as well as dealt with.

    Does unclean properly


    If your dishes and cutleries come out of the dishwasher and still look filthy or dirty, your spray arms might be an issue. In many cases, the spray arms can get obstructed, and it will certainly call for a fast tidy or a replacement to function successfully again.

    Dishwasher Won’t Drain? 8 Steps to Fix It


    Run the Disposal


    A full garbage disposal or an air gap in a connecting hose can prevent water from properly draining out of the dishwasher. Simply running the disposal for about 30 seconds may fix the issue.


    Check for Blockages


    Check the bottom of the dishwasher to make sure that an item or pieces of food haven't fallen from the rack to block the water flow.


    Load the Dishwasher Correctly


    Make sure you’re loading the dishwasher correctly. Read the manufacturers’ instructions or owner’s manual for tips and directions on how to load dishes for best results.


    Clean or Change the Filter


    You may have a clogged dishwasher filter that’s preventing water from draining. Many homeowners don’t realize that dishwasher filters need to be cleaned regularly. Check your owner’s manual to see where the filter is located on your dishwasher, and for instructions on how and when to clean it. For many dishwashers, the filter can be found on the inside bottom of the appliance.


    Inspect the Drain Hose


    Check the drain hose connecting to the sink and garbage disposal. Straighten any kinks that you may see, which could be causing the problem. Blow through the hose or poke a wire hanger through to check for clogs. Make sure the hose seal is tight, too.


    Try Vinegar and Baking Soda


    Mix together about one cup each of baking soda and vinegar and pour the mixture into the standing water at the bottom of the dishwasher. Leave for about 20 minutes. If the water is draining or starting to drain at that time, rinse with hot water and then run the dishwasher’s rinse cycle. That may be enough to help loosen any clogs or debris that are preventing the dishwasher from draining properly.


    Listen to Your Machine While It's Running


    Listen to your dishwasher while it’s running a cycle. If it doesn’t make the usual operating sounds, particularly if it’s making a humming or clicking noise, the drain pump and motor may need replacing. If this occurs, it may be time to call a professional for help.
